Power saving option doesn't work after scheduled recording

(using the latest DVBV beta)

 

I've noticed that whenever I've used a scheduled recording (with "Close DVBViewer" after recording enabled), my display won't shut down after the time I've set in power saving properties in Control Panel. If I start DVBV manually and close it, the power saving starts working again. I haven't tested whether the system goes to standby mode or hibernates after the scheduled recording as I never use those features. I have set DVBV to allow screensaver.

 

I have a GeForce 6600GT card, v81.98 drivers.

There is also a problem which exists during the recording.

 

Whilst recording, screen saver kicks in but TFT panel does not go to power saving mode. That is, screensaver yes, but LCD back light on even with Blank (=black) screen saver. Monitor never goes to power off state. Naturally, energy star compliant monitor power off works normally when DVBViewer is not running.

 

Windows XP SP2, DVBV V3.5.0.1., nVidia 7800GT, 91.47 drivers. Has been like this with all previous driver releases and with previous DVBVier releases. In Settings->Options->General I have not selected "Prevent screen saver".
